WELCOME TO NOVA SCOTIA SHARE OUR TRAILS ASSOCIATION

Working together to share our trails

We are a non-profit association of Nova Scotia residents who would like to see a shared trail system in all rural areas. 

​

Our mission is to ensure fair, equitable and universal access to all Nova Scotia abandoned rail corridors by various means including: walking, bicycling, equestrians, legally registered off highway vehicles (OHV's, ATV's and Snowmobiles) and motorized and non-motorized mobility aids.
